Multi-agent systems : an introduction
Michael J Wooldridge
This is the first textbook to be explicitly designed for use as a course text for an undergraduate/graduate course on multi-agent systems. Assuming only a basic understanding of computer science, this text provides an introduction to all the main issues in the theory and practice of intelligent agents and multi-agent systems. * The companion Web Site includes sample exercises, lecture slidest and hyperlinks to software referred to in the book * Introduces agents, explains what agents are, how they are constructed and how they can be made to co-operate effectively with one another in large-scale systems * Introduces the main issues surrounding the design of intelligent agents * Introduces a number of typical applications for agent technology
